文中分析了悬臂梁的振动情况,建立了悬臂梁的动力学系统方程,设计了基于最优模糊控制算法的悬臂梁振动控制系统。系统将采集进来的信号通过最优控制理论计算得到理论输出值,建立拥有最优解的模糊控制规则,使得一个输入得到一个最优的控制输出,从而产生相应的抑制力来减弱梁的振动。使用Matlab对振动控制系统进行了仿真,结果表明该算法能够很好地抑制悬臂梁的振动。%This paper analyzed the vibration of the cantilever, established the dynamic equations of a cantilever system, and designed the cantilever vibration control system based on fuzzy optimal control algorithm. The system calculated the collected signal into the output value by the theory of optimal control theory, and then the optimal solution fuzzy control rules were established by the output value. The system made the input into an optimal control output, resulting in a corresponding decrease vibration suppression force to the beam. Vibration control system using Matlab simulation results show that the algorithm can suppress vibration of the cantilever.
